在数字化时代,数据分析已经成为一项不可或缺的技能。而Echarts作为一款强大的可视化工具,可以帮助我们轻松地将数据转化为图表,让复杂的数据更加直观易懂。对于新手来说,掌握Echarts图表制作是一个很好的起点。以下是一份详细的Echarts图表制作视频教程,帮助您轻松入门学习数据分析。
一、Echarts简介
1. 什么是Echarts?
Echarts是由百度团队开发的一个使用JavaScript实现的开源可视化库,可以轻松地嵌入到各种网页和应用程序中。它提供了丰富的图表类型,包括柱状图、折线图、饼图、地图等,能够满足不同场景下的数据可视化需求。
2. Echarts的特点
- 高性能:Echarts采用Canvas渲染,支持大规模数据可视化。
- 易用性:Echarts提供了丰富的API和配置项,方便用户快速上手。
- 跨平台:Echarts可以在多种浏览器和操作系统上运行。
二、Echarts基础教程
1. 环境搭建
在开始学习Echarts之前,需要先搭建一个开发环境。以下是几种常见的方法:
- 在线编辑器:使用在线编辑器,如CodePen、JSFiddle等,可以方便地编写和测试Echarts代码。
- 本地开发:在本地安装Node.js和npm,使用npm安装Echarts包,并通过HTML、CSS和JavaScript进行开发。
2. Echarts基本语法
以下是一个简单的Echarts实例,展示如何创建一个柱状图:
// 引入Echarts主模块
var echarts = require('echarts/lib/echarts');
// 引入柱状图
require('echarts/lib/chart/bar');
// 引入提示框和标题组件
require('echarts/lib/component/tooltip');
require('echarts/lib/component/title');
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: 'Echarts入门示例'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
3. Echarts图表类型
Echarts提供了丰富的图表类型,以下是部分常见类型:
- 柱状图:适用于展示各类数据的比较。
- 折线图:适用于展示数据的变化趋势。
- 饼图:适用于展示数据的占比关系。
- 地图:适用于展示地理位置信息。
三、进阶教程
1. 动画效果
Echarts支持丰富的动画效果,可以通过配置项实现数据动态加载、图表交互等效果。
2. 交互式图表
Echarts提供了多种交互式组件,如数据筛选、排序、缩放等,可以提升用户的使用体验。
3. 数据处理
Echarts支持多种数据处理方式,如数据格式转换、数据合并等,可以帮助用户更好地处理和分析数据。
四、总结
Echarts是一款功能强大的可视化工具,可以帮助我们轻松地将数据转化为图表,为数据分析提供有力支持。通过学习Echarts图表制作,我们可以快速入门数据分析领域。希望这份视频教程能够帮助您掌握Echarts,开启您的数据分析之旅!
